A super resilient mom trusts her intuition .If Spider-Man has a Spider-Sense that allows him to detect danger, a mom has a strong intuition . In fact, Tokyo researchers found in an imaging study that a mother’s impulse to love and protect her child appears to be hard-wired to her brain. Maybe that’s why she wakes up in the middle of the night if she feels that something’s wrong with her kids; she can tell from across the room who among her children broke the vase; she knows how to soothe a broken heart by whipping up a hearty meal after losing a football game.

A super resilient mom balances family and work.
Moms don’t let life get in the way when it comes to their job or passion . Sure, raising a family in a cash-strapped economy and morally challenged society might be a herculean task, but they manage to look beyond the hardships and instead get a strong grip over their family and work life. In fact, a Pew Research Center analysis of the U.S. Census data says a record of 40% of all households with children under the age of 18 in the US include mothers who are either the sole or primary source of income for the family, compared to 11% in 1960.
